About Cheese, ricotta, whole milk

Ricotta is a soft, fresh, slightly grainy cheese with a mild, gently sweet, milky flavor. Traditionally made from the whey left over from other cheeses (its name means 'recooked'), it's the creamy filling in lasagne and cannoli, and just as good spread on toast with honey or fruit.

As cheeses go it's relatively gentle: a good source of protein and calcium, with phosphorus and B12, and — being fresh and unsalted compared with aged cheeses — lower in sodium. The whole-milk version is richer; part-skim trims some of the fat.

Soft, mild and versatile, ricotta moves easily between savory and sweet — a lighter, fresher cheese that adds creaminess and protein without the salt and intensity of the aged kinds.

Frequently asked questions

How many calories are in Cheese, ricotta, whole milk?

There are 157 calories in 100 g of Cheese, ricotta, whole milk, or about 195 calories in 0.5 cup (124 g).

How much protein is in Cheese, ricotta, whole milk?

Cheese, ricotta, whole milk contains 7.8 g of protein per 100 g.

How many carbs are in Cheese, ricotta, whole milk?

Cheese, ricotta, whole milk has 6.9 g of carbohydrates per 100 g.

How much fat is in Cheese, ricotta, whole milk?

Cheese, ricotta, whole milk provides 11.0 g of total fat per 100 g.

What is Cheese, ricotta, whole milk a good source of?

Cheese, ricotta, whole milk is an excellent source of Vitamin B12 (33% DV), Selenium (26% DV) and Riboflavin (B2) (25% DV) and a good source of Calcium, Protein, Vitamin A (RAE), Pantothenic Acid (B5), Phosphorus and Zinc (per 100 g). Daily Values are based on a 2,000-calorie diet.
